SUBJECT: Fireworks Permit for 4th of July at Starfire
ISSUE
Require City Council approval for the annual fireworks permit for the Tukwila Parks and
Recreation Family 4 at Starfire Sports Complex.
BACKGROUND
The City of Tukwila has been sponsoring a family oriented 4th of July celebration for the last 13
years. This is one of the most successful City sponsored events in terms of public attendance
and participation. This event will draw in excess of 5,000 people to the park to view and
participate in the festivities scheduled by Parks and Recreation.
DISCUSSION
Parks and Recreation has retained the same fireworks company, Western Display Fireworks,
Ltd., a company with 61 years of experience in public displays. We will use the same location as
last year to avoid protecting the sports turf fields in the Northeast corner of the facility. This
fireworks discharge location will be in the Southwest corner of the facility on the natural grass
fields. Additionally, the largest aerial shell will be reduced from 6" to 3"; this allows for a smaller
safety perimeter. Western Display has also proposed several ground displays that the crowd will
be able to see when looking south.
FINANCIAL IMPACT
This event is funded through the Parks and Recreation Department.
RECOMMENDATION
Staff recommends that Council approve the permit as presented at the June 16, 2014 Council
meeting under the Consent Agenda.

Re: Public Fireworks Display Permit
I have reviewed the permit application information provided by Western Display
Fireworks, Ltd. They have applied for the permit for a public fireworks display at the
Starfire Sports Complex, 14800 Starfire Way. Western Display is a licensed Pyrotechnic
Company with the State of Washington.
The display will be held in conjunction with the City's planned event on the 4th of July,
"Family Fun at the Fort ", being organized by the Parks and Recreation Department. This
will be a 20 to 30 minute show starting at approximately 2200 hours. The fireworks will
be transported to the site in the AM of July 4th and will be under the required supervision
until they are discharged. The mortar tubes and support equipment will be brought to
the location on July 4th
The application was reviewed to WAC 212 -17 and accepted industry standards, and we
find everything is within these guidelines.
The display will be held again in the Southwest corner of the facility. This change has
eliminated the concerns regarding the railroad right — of — way, Seattle Sounders FC
practice fields and the limited access this allows. In addition, we will no longer have a
portion of the fallout area within the City of Renton. We will however, have a small
portion of the 6720 Fort Dent Way Office building within the South edge of the fallout
zone.
Crowd control can be a potential issue, as the crowd that assembles to watch the fire
works show has increased each and every year. Last year the traffic leaving the site
was managed with the available Tukwila Police on site and available patrol units. To
mitigate these issues I believe the following measures should be done:

• Stage two fire apparatus at the site: one apparatus on each side of the river in order to
cover the 6720 Fort Dent Office building. Apparatus shall be out of service during the
display and for 30 minutes following the display.
• Have Tukwila Police provide crowd control during the public display. A minimum of 4
officers will be required. Provide traffic control to the Fort Dent Way and Interurban Ave
intersection to expedite traffic flow. (2 additional Tukwila Police shall be available to
respond to the site if requested.)
• Comply with Fire Works Permit Conditions attached.

FIREWORKS PERMIT CONDITIONS
To: Western Display Fireworks, Ltd.
From: B /C. Tomaso, Fire Marshal
Re: July 4th Fireworks display, 14800 Starfire Way, Tukwila, WA 98168
Date: May 22, 2014
1. Notify Washington State Patrol at 425 - 649 -4658.
2. Notify FAA specialist at 425 - 227 -2536 or 425 - 227 -2500.
3. Establish Safety perimeter a minimum of 30 minutes prior to display start.
4. Have Pyrotechnicians in visible uniform clothing.
5. No Pyrotechnics shall be delivered to site prior to the day of the display.
6. All personnel inside the safety perimeter shall use Personnel Protective equipment as
outlined in NFPA 1123.
7. Only Pyrotechnicians, Safety Monitors and Fire Watch personnel will be within the
safety perimeter.
8. Portable fire extinguishers shall be in place, prior to unloading of pyrotechnics from
transport vehicle. (2A 20 BC Minimum Size)
9. 4 - Tukwila Police officers shall be on site a minimum of 30 minutes prior to the start of
the display for crowd control and shall remain for a minimum of 30 minutes past the end
of the display or the crowd disperses. (2 additional Tukwila Police officers shall be
available to respond to the site if requested.)

10. Tukwila Fire Department shall inspect mortar racks prior to loading of any pyrotechnic
shells.
11.Tukwila Fire Department shall inspect all static displays upon completion of set up.
12.Two Tukwila Fire Department apparatus shall be on location prior to the start of the
display. (One will be an overtime staffed Engine)
13.Two additional overtime firefighters will be the designated fire watch personnel assigned
to the Starfire turf practice fields.
14.Any breech of the safety perimeter shall suspend the display until the perimeter is
cleared and re — established.
15. Upon completion of the display, the fallout area shall be checked for unexploded shells.
Cleaning of debris, if not practical on the night of the event shall be at first light the next
day.
16. No combustible materials shall be stored inside the safety perimeter.

A. Fireworks Permit for July 4 Event at Starfire Sports Complex
Staff is seeking Council approval of a Fireworks Permit Application submitted by Western
Display Fireworks Ltd. for the fireworks display at the City's annual 4th of July Celebration at
Starfire Sports Complex. The application has been approved by the Fire Marshal and found to
be in compliance with standards and regulations, and this vendor and launch location have
been working well. UNANIMOUS APPROVAL. FORWARD TO JUNE 16, 2014 REGULAR
CONSENT AGENDA.
B. Resolution and Annual Report: City of Opportunity Scholarship
Staff is seeking Council approval of a resolution that would amend the requirements of the
Tukwila City of Opportunity Scholarship as a result of lessons learned from the inaugural 2014
process. Committee discussions on the four areas of modification recommended by staff are
summarized as follows:
• Define "substantial financial need" as family income that does not exceed 70 percent of
the state's median income. The Committee requested more information regarding median
income levels for the city, county and state. While discussing a balance of need versus
merit -based award criteria, Committee members expressed an interest in an expanded
community service component to the application.
• Modify the selection committee makeup to include the option of a representative from the
City Council in addition to or instead of the Council President, and the option of additional
City Staff and School District representatives, not to exceed seven total Committee
members per year. The Committee agreed with this modification.
• Increase the total amount of the annual scholarship fund to $10,000, allowing for the
potential of additional recipients and /or more substantial awards. The Committee agreed
with this modification.
• Change eligibility standards to exclude City employees and elected officials in keeping
with common practice and on the advice of the City Attorney. The Committee did not
agree to this modification but would like to forward both options to the Committee of the
Whole for discussion. Committee Chair Seal suggested that if employee relatives are
included, their names be blacked out during the selection committee review process.
RETURN TO COMMITTEE FOR FURTHER DISCUSSION.
